Про проект Ua.trud.com
Формат даних
- <?xml version="1.0" encoding="UTF-8"?>
- <joblist date=Mon, 19 Dec 2011 15:26:13 +0200>
- <categories>
- <category id="1">Інше</category>
- <category id="2">Сировина</category>
- <category id="3">Ресторани, кафе, їдальні, фастфуд</category>
- </categories>
- <regions>
- <region id="1">Москва</region>
- <region id="2">Вологда</region>
- <region id="3">Рязань</region>
- </regions>
- <jobs>
- <job id="1">
- <title>Менеджер по ЗЕД (імпорт)</title>
- <employer>XADO</employer>
- <url>http://site.com/rabota/vacancy-2576739.html</url>
- <description> пошук і залучення нових іноземних постачальників; робота з вже існуючими постачальниками (проведення переговорів, ведення ділової переписки); підготовка повного пакету документів (замовлення, договори і д.р.); супровід і контроль поставок; переклади технічної документації, контрактів та документів супроводу замовлень; ведення внутрішньої звітності. </description>
- <updated>25.11.2011 17:19:13</updated>
- <salary></salary>
- <expires>25.12.2011 16:55:07</expires>
- <region>1</region>
- <category>1,2</category>
- </job>
- </jobs>
- <cvs>
- <cv id="1">
- <title>Няня</title>
- <name>Іванова Ізольда Юсуповна</name>
- <url>http://site.com/resume/123.html</url>
- <description>Бухгалтер з багаторічним досвідом</description>
- <updated>27.10.2011 15:37:17</updated>
- <salary></salary>
- <expires>28.01.2012 17:12:24</expires>
- <region>1</region>
- <category>5</category>
- </cv>
- </cvs>
- </joblist>
- Приклад файлу-вивантаження
-
Блок categories визначає переліки категорій. Список плоский, без вкладеності; назва категорії буде використано як додаткові (більш вагомі) ключові слова при пошуку.
Блок regions визначає переліки регіонів.
Блок jobs містить список вакансій. Рекомендується вивантажувати тільки вакансії, оновлені за останні дві доби.
Блок cvs містить список резюме. Рекомендується вивантажувати тільки резюме, оновлені за останні дві доби.
Обов'язковими полями для вакансії є: id, title, category, region, url. Поля category і region можуть містити одне або кілька значень, розділених комою.
Обов'язковими полями для резюме є: id, title, category, region, url. Поля category і region можуть містити одне або кілька значень, розділених комою.
-
Файл должен быть корректным (well-formed) XML-документом. Проверить файл на корректность можно, например, валідатором від W3C
Кодування файлу - UTF8.
Поле id завжди числове беззнаковое.
Потрібно вказати мінімум одну категорію і один регіон для кожної вакансії і кожного резюме.
На PHP дату в необхідному форматі можна отримати викликом date ("r")
Для видалення вакансії або резюме з сайту можна відправити її з датою придатності в минулому; такі вакансії і резюме на сайті не показуються.